One becomes fearless when Krishna is in the centre of his life

Being human there are two major problem with all of us; Fear and Grief. One become fearful when he thinks of his future what is going to be the next with me and one filled with Grief if something bad happens in his past life.

These two things are very common with all of us and that is why we all live our life in very stress. But if person live Krishna centered life and keep Krishna in center he does not have to worry for both.

There is a pastimes when all cow heard boys friends of Krishna went to forest to gaze the cows and saw a gigantic form of cave and entered into it, one boy asked to another is not something strange in this cave, as we have never seen before?

But another boy told, don't worry if it is something else apart from cave then Krishna is there to protect us from all the danger. 

Actually that was a great demon Aghasura (form of big snake) sent by Kamsa to kill KRISHNA. 

But all boys were fearless they already knew whatever happens, Krishna will surely protect us from all the situations.

So, now the question , how can we bring this type of confidence in us? 

As is it already mentioned in Srimad Bhagwad Gita (in glories of Bhagwad Gita);

गीता शास्त्रम् इदम् पुण्यम् याह पठेत प्रियतः पुमान 

विष्णो पदम् अवाप्नोति भय -शोकादि वर्जिताह। 

So, it is very simple one who take shelter of Bhagwad Gita (it is understood that the person has taken shelter of Krishna) and read it regularly then his all fear and grief goes away.
